Transaction 7bc5037b4deb0532fc1a2ae7ac15d7d6ee44123ed250eafcf24df046edfc80d1

1 Input
2 Outputs
  • 7bc5037b4deb0532fc1a2ae7ac15d7d6ee44123ed250eafcf24df046edfc80d1:0
  • value  40000000
    address  131HU9gkX619VktVyLVQMGrPVDdcEJqxUV
  • 7bc5037b4deb0532fc1a2ae7ac15d7d6ee44123ed250eafcf24df046edfc80d1:1
  • value  15991004
    address  3MFQCRsnW4QrJmwBJ6cpC3GbNRqELfmeqz